import sys
from _typeshed import AnyPath, StrPath, SupportsWrite
from typing import (
AbstractSet,
Any,
Callable,
ClassVar,
Dict,
Iterable,
Iterator,
List,
Mapping,
MutableMapping,
Optional,
Pattern,
Sequence,
Tuple,
Type,
TypeVar,
Union,
overload,
)
from typing_extensions import Literal
# Internal type aliases
_section = Mapping[str, str]
_parser = MutableMapping[str, _section]
_converter = Callable[[str], Any]
_converters = Dict[str, _converter]
_T = TypeVar("_T")
if sys.version_info >= (3, 7):
_Path = AnyPath
else:
_Path = StrPath
DEFAULTSECT: str
MAX_INTERPOLATION_DEPTH: int
class Interpolation:
def before_get(self, parser: _parser, section: str, option: str, value: str, defaults: _section) -> str: ...
def before_set(self, parser: _parser, section: str, option: str, value: str) -> str: ...
def before_read(self, parser: _parser, section: str, option: str, value: str) -> str: ...
def before_write(self, parser: _parser, section: str, option: str, value: str) -> str: ...
class BasicInterpolation(Interpolation): ...
class ExtendedInterpolation(Interpolation): ...
class LegacyInterpolation(Interpolation):
def before_get(self, parser: _parser, section: str, option: str, value: str, vars: _section) -> str: ...
class RawConfigParser(_parser):
_SECT_TMPL: ClassVar[str] = ... # Undocumented
_OPT_TMPL: ClassVar[str] = ... # Undocumented
_OPT_NV_TMPL: ClassVar[str] = ... # Undocumented
SECTCRE: Pattern[str] = ...
OPTCRE: ClassVar[Pattern[str]] = ...
OPTCRE_NV: ClassVar[Pattern[str]] = ... # Undocumented
NONSPACECRE: ClassVar[Pattern[str]] = ... # Undocumented
BOOLEAN_STATES: ClassVar[Mapping[str, bool]] = ... # Undocumented
default_section: str
@overload
def __init__(
self,
defaults: Optional[Mapping[str, Optional[str]]] = ...,
dict_type: Type[Mapping[str, str]] = ...,
allow_no_value: Literal[True] = ...,
*,
delimiters: Sequence[str] = ...,
comment_prefixes: Sequence[str] = ...,
inline_comment_prefixes: Optional[Sequence[str]] = ...,
strict: bool = ...,
empty_lines_in_values: bool = ...,
default_section: str = ...,
interpolation: Optional[Interpolation] = ...,
converters: _converters = ...,
) -> None: ...
@overload
def __init__(
self,
defaults: Optional[_section] = ...,
dict_type: Type[Mapping[str, str]] = ...,
allow_no_value: bool = ...,
*,
delimiters: Sequence[str] = ...,
comment_prefixes: Sequence[str] = ...,
inline_comment_prefixes: Optional[Sequence[str]] = ...,
strict: bool = ...,
empty_lines_in_values: bool = ...,
default_section: str = ...,
interpolation: Optional[Interpolation] = ...,
converters: _converters = ...,
) -> None: ...
def __len__(self) -> int: ...
def __getitem__(self, section: str) -> SectionProxy: ...
def __setitem__(self, section: str, options: _section) -> None: ...
def __delitem__(self, section: str) -> None: ...
def __iter__(self) -> Iterator[str]: ...
def defaults(self) -> _section: ...
def sections(self) -> List[str]: ...
def add_section(self, section: str) -> None: ...
def has_section(self, section: str) -> bool: ...
def options(self, section: str) -> List[str]: ...
def has_option(self, section: str, option: str) -> bool: ...
def read(self, filenames: Union[_Path, Iterable[_Path]], encoding: Optional[str] = ...) -> List[str]: ...
def read_file(self, f: Iterable[str], source: Optional[str] = ...) -> None: ...
def read_string(self, string: str, source: str = ...) -> None: ...
def read_dict(self, dictionary: Mapping[str, Mapping[str, Any]], source: str = ...) -> None: ...
def readfp(self, fp: Iterable[str], filename: Optional[str] = ...) -> None: ...
# These get* methods are partially applied (with the same names) in
# SectionProxy; the stubs should be kept updated together
@overload
def getint(self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> int: ...
@overload
def getint(
self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..., fallback: _T = ...
) -> Union[int, _T]: ...
@overload
def getfloat(self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> float: ...
@overload
def getfloat(
self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..., fallback: _T = ...
) -> Union[float, _T]: ...
@overload
def getboolean(self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> bool: ...
@overload
def getboolean(
self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..., fallback: _T = ...
) -> Union[bool, _T]: ...
def _get_conv(
self,
section: str,
option: str,
conv: Callable[[str], _T],
*,
raw: bool = ...,
vars: Optional[_section] = ...,
fallback: _T = ...,
) -> _T: ...
# This is incompatible with MutableMapping so we ignore the type
@overload # type: ignore
def get(self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> str: ...
@overload
def get(
self, section: str,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..., fallback: _T
) -> Union[str, _T]: ...
@overload
def items(self,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> AbstractSet[Tuple[str, SectionProxy]]: ...
@overload
def items(self, section: str,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> List[Tuple[str, str]]: ...
def set(self, section: str, option: str, value: Optional[str] = ...) -> None: ...
def write(self, fp: SupportsWrite[str], space_around_delimiters: bool = ...) -> None: ...
def remove_option(self, section: str, option: str) -> bool: ...
def remove_section(self, section: str) -> bool: ...
def optionxform(self, optionstr: str) -> str: ...
class ConfigParser(RawConfigParser): ...
class SafeConfigParser(ConfigParser): ...
class SectionProxy(MutableMapping[str, str]):
def __init__(self, parser: RawConfigParser, name: str) -> None: ...
def __getitem__(self, key: str) -> str: ...
def __setitem__(self, key: str, value: str) -> None: ...
def __delitem__(self, key: str) -> None: ...
def __contains__(self, key: object) -> bool: ...
def __len__(self) -> int: ...
def __iter__(self) -> Iterator[str]: ...
@property
def parser(self) -> RawConfigParser: ...
@property
def name(self) -> str: ...
def get(self, option: str, fallback: Optional[str] = ..., *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..., _impl: Optional[Any] = ..., **kwargs: Any) -> str: ... # type: ignore
# These are partially-applied version of the methods with the same names in
# RawConfigParser; the stubs should be kept updated together
@overload
def getint(self,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> int: ...
@overload
def getint(self, option: str, fallback: _T = ..., *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> Union[int, _T]: ...
@overload
def getfloat(self,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> float: ...
@overload
def getfloat(
self, option: str, fallback: _T = ..., *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...
) -> Union[float, _T]: ...
@overload
def getboolean(self, option: str, *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...) -> bool: ...
@overload
def getboolean(
self, option: str, fallback: _T = ..., *, raw: bool = ..., vars: Optional[_section] = ...
) -> Union[bool, _T]: ...
# SectionProxy can have arbitrary attributes when custom converters are used
def __getattr__(self, key: str) -> Callable[..., Any]: ...
class ConverterMapping(MutableMapping[str, Optional[_converter]]):
GETTERCRE: Pattern[Any]
def __init__(self, parser: RawConfigParser) -> None: ...
def __getitem__(self, key: str) -> _converter: ...
def __setitem__(self, key: str, value: Optional[_converter]) -> None: ...
def __delitem__(self, key: str) -> None: ...
def __iter__(self) -> Iterator[str]: ...
def __len__(self) -> int: ...
class Error(Exception):
message: str
def __init__(self, msg: str = ...) -> None: ...
class NoSectionError(Error):
section: str
def __init__(self, section: str) -> None: ...
class DuplicateSectionError(Error):
section: str
source: Optional[str]
lineno: Optional[int]
def __init__(self, section: str, source: Optional[str] = ..., lineno: Optional[int] = ...) -> None: ...
class DuplicateOptionError(Error):
section: str
option: str
source: Optional[str]
lineno: Optional[int]
def __init__(self, section: str, option: str, source: Optional[str] = ..., lineno: Optional[int] = ...) -> None: ...
class NoOptionError(Error):
section: str
option: str
def __init__(self, option: str, section: str) -> None: ...
class InterpolationError(Error):
section: str
option: str
def __init__(self, option: str, section: str, msg: str) -> None: ...
class InterpolationDepthError(InterpolationError):
def __init__(self, option: str, section: str, rawval: object) -> None: ...
class InterpolationMissingOptionError(InterpolationError):
reference: str
def __init__(self, option: str, section: str, rawval: object, reference: str) -> None: ...
class InterpolationSyntaxError(InterpolationError): ...
class ParsingError(Error):
source: str
errors: List[Tuple[int, str]]
def __init__(self, source: Optional[str] = ..., filename: Optional[str] = ...) -> None: ...
def append(self, lineno: int, line: str) -> None: ...
class MissingSectionHeaderError(ParsingError):
lineno: int
line: str
def __init__(self, filename: str, lineno: int, line: str) -> None: ...
